Costa Rica Boosts Its Audiovisual Industry Through New Market

Costa Rica Media Market Welcomes Global Engagement
Costa Rica Media Market is set to invigorate the local audiovisual industry on June 24–25. This event will take place in San José and is expected to draw over 500 business meetings, showcasing creative talents from producers, buyers, and experts across 19 nations.
Collaboration for Growth in the Audiovisual Sector
Organized by the Costa Rica Film Commission, the Trade and Investment Promotion Agency (PROCOMER), and the Ministry of Culture and Youth, this event emphasizes the unique opportunities Costa Rica offers for audiovisual productions. Attendees will explore six Film Friendly Zones, all designed to display the country’s myriad advantages and resources for filmmakers.
Business Meetings and Opportunities
The Costa Rica Media Market will host significant interactions with more than 50 international buyers from diverse regions. Participants will include professionals from Argentina, Brazil, Germany, and other countries, advancing collaborative projects and initiating co-productions to amplify regional content.

Enhanced Networking and Learning Experiences
This year’s market features business roundtables, expert panels, and masterclasses aimed at delivering invaluable insights into the industry. Project showcases are a notable aspect of the agenda, featuring works from the Costa Rica International Film Festival, including projects from Tres Puertos Cine, a residency for Latin American film initiatives.

Exploring Costa Rica’s Unique Filming Landscape
The Fam Tours, scheduled for June 26–28, are integral to showcasing Costa Rica as a prime filming location. Participants will experience firsthand the diverse landscapes that include lush jungles, scenic coasts, and rich historical towns. These tours reflect the logistical advantages and creative environments conducive to film production.

Why Choose Costa Rica for Film Production?
Costa Rica boasts an attractive portfolio for international filming endeavors. Notable advantages include diverse locations in proximity, a skilled workforce, legal stability, and attractive fiscal incentives, such as tax exemptions for international productions. These features make the country competitive and efficient for any studio or production company seeking quality outputs.
